Product Details
This 2021 1/2 Gold Eagle, the first of the series to feature the redesigned reverse of the Gold Eagle, is certified as being in flawless MS-70 condition, adding to its collectible appeal.

Coin Highlights:
  • Contains 1/2 oz actual Gold weight.
  • NGC encapsulation protects and guarantees the perfect 70 condition of the coin.
  • Don Everhart hand-signed label.
  • Obverse: Adapted from Augustus Saint-Gaudens’ famed Gold Double Eagle design, which features Lady Liberty walking confidently against the sun’s rays.
  • Reverse: A bold close-up portrait of an eagle, designed by Jennie Norris. This design is the first new design introduced since the series began in 1986.
